Clan Mulrian or Clan Ryan as it is known today is known by the familiar device of three silver Griffon's heads on a field of red. Our clan motto is: Malo Mori Quam Foedari. Translated from Latin it means: I would rather die than be dishonored. It has been my experience that this is true.
